Why there is no universal best platform
Pilot recruitment is fragmented. Airlines, flight schools, cadet programs, and assessment providers can use different combinations of psychometric tests, technical knowledge, English, interviews, group exercises, personality questionnaires, and simulator stages.
A platform can be excellent for one campaign and poorly matched to another. The correct question is not “Which site has the most exercises?” It is “Which preparation route matches the assessment I will actually take?”
First choice: official and employer-provided material
Official candidate guides, invitation emails, authorized sample tests, device checks, and practice environments should be reviewed before commercial products.
Their advantages are:
- authoritative terminology;
- current campaign instructions;
- accurate technical requirements;
- authorized sample interfaces;
- clear rules about timing, retakes, and assessment-day conduct.
Their limitation is volume. Official practice may provide orientation rather than a full training program.
Use commercial preparation to fill a defined gap, not to replace official instructions.

Specialist coaching and supervised courses
Human coaching can add value for:
- structured interview feedback;
- communication and competency examples;
- group exercise behavior;
- simulator preparation;
- supervised aptitude practice;
- accountability and study planning.
The value depends heavily on coach qualifications, current campaign knowledge, session structure, and ethical boundaries. Avoid anyone promising confidential questions or guaranteed selection.
Self-study and free preparation
A candidate can make meaningful progress with:
- mental arithmetic;
- numerical, verbal, abstract, and spatial reasoning;
- memory and attention exercises;
- physics fundamentals;
- aviation English;
- interview reflection;
- sleep, equipment, and test-environment preparation.
Free preparation is particularly appropriate before the assessment system is known. It reduces the pressure to buy a course too early.
How to choose in seven steps
- Identify the employer or school.
- Read every official instruction.
- Identify the named test provider or stages.
- Verify device and timing requirements.
- Review official samples.
- Compare only products that match the confirmed route.
- Buy the narrowest product that solves a real preparation gap.

Warning for ATC candidates
Pilot and air traffic controller selection can use overlapping words such as attention, memory, spatial reasoning, multitasking, and decision-making. The job simulations, interfaces, rules, and selection systems remain different.
